Problem 3:
The shaft shown in the figure below is made from an aluminum jacket ACB with GAlu=27,000 MPa, and a steel core AC and CB with GStl=75,000MPa. If it is fixed at B and a torque of T0=600N-m is applied at its rigid end cap at A as shown,
draw F.B.D.s for your calculation;
draw the internal torque T diagrams for the aluminum jacket and the steel core;
determine the internal torque TStl in the steel core and TAlu in the aluminum jacket;
calculate the maximum shear stress (max)Stl in the steel core and (max)Alu in the aluminum jacket.
